Hang Seng Bank names new boss for mainland
Hang Seng Bank Ltd, the Hong Kong lender controlled by HSBC Holdings Inc, said yesterday that it appointed Gordon Lam as new chief executive of its subsidiary on Chinese mainland while his predecessor Dorothy Sit will remain vice chair of Hang Seng China.
Sit was also appointed as the head of China business of Hang Seng Bank last Thursday along with Lam’s appointment, the lender said in an emailed announcement last night.
Lam, 54, joined Hang Seng China in 2012 as deputy chief executive. Prior to that, he worked for HSBC for more than 20 years.
